Какими способами цифровые разработки осуществляют проверку надежности
Какими способами цифровые разработки осуществляют проверку надежности
Современная проектирование ПО нереализуема без всеобъемлющей методологии проверки стандартов. Любой день огромное количество клиентов взаимодействуют с различными сервисами, веб-сервисами и цифровыми продуктами, предполагая от них надежной работы, безопасности и выполнения описанному опциям. Система обеспечения качества цифровых разработок составляет собой комплексную методологию тестирования, анализа и мониторинга, которая поддерживает решение на всех фазах его жизненного цикла.
Что конкретно определяют качеством в цифровых разработках
Стандарт ПО vavada определяется совокупностью параметров, которые в комплексе определяют потребительский взаимодействие и системную стабильность решения. Возможности является главным показателем – система призвана выполнять все объявленные функции в соответственности с системными требованиями и ожиданиями клиентов.
Стабильность технического продукта выражается в его способности работать без неполадок в разнообразных ситуациях применения. Это содержит стабильность к неожиданным входным данным, адекватную управление неверных ситуаций и возможность восстанавливаться после краткосрочных сбоев. Эффективность показывает темп реализации операций, время отклика приложения на пользовательские операции и результативность задействования системных возможностей.
Удобство использования показывает, насколько доступным и удобным является контакт с приложением для конечных пользователей. Здесь включаются практичность интерфейса вавада, понятность управления, открытость для людей с специальными потребностями и общая доступность освоения функционала.
Обслуживаемость программного кода воздействует на возможность его дальнейшего улучшения и поддержки. Качественно разработанный скрипт должен быть понятным, структурированным, хорошо описанным и упорядоченным таким образом, чтобы иные программисты были способны без труда в нем разобраться и внести необходимые корректировки.
Как тестируют, что всё действует по спецификациям
Проверка соответствия технического продукта требованиям инициируется с тщательного исследования ТЗ и рабочих спецификаций. Команда проверки разрабатывает развернутые сценарии, которые охватывают все указанные в документации сценарии использования приложения vavada. Каждый тест-кейс имеет ясные этапы для повторения, ожидаемые результаты и параметры положительного завершения контроля.
Матрица трассируемости требований помогает убедиться, что любое требование охвачено соответствующими тестами, а любой тест соединен с специфическим требованием. Это дает возможность предотвратить случаев, когда существенная функциональность становится неконтролируемой или когда расходуется период на проверку несуществующих спецификаций.
Заключительное испытание проводится с вовлечением клиентов или делегатов бизнес-подразделений, которые максимально полно представляют, как система обязана функционировать в действительных обстоятельствах. Они тестируют не только технологическую корректность воплощения, но и согласованность деловым операциям и потребительским ожиданиям.
Возвратное проверка обеспечивает, что свежие корректировки в системе не повредили прежде функционировавший функционал. После любого апдейта или коррекции ошибок запускается набор тестов, контролирующих главные операции программы.
Почему проверка начинается еще до создания скрипта
Нынешний подход к гарантированию надежности подразумевает деятельное вовлечение профессионалов по контролю на самых ранних этапах программы:
- Анализ спецификаций дает возможность обнаружить ошибки, конфликты и пробелы в технологических условиях до инициирования кодирования.
- Создание проверочных сценариев содействует лучше осознать ожидаемое работу приложения и конкретизировать нюансы выполнения.
- Подготовка тестовых информации и тестовой инфраструктуры экономит период на дальнейших фазах.
- Составление стратегии контроля выявляет нужные ресурсы и сроки для надежной тестирования.
- Разработка автоматизированных проверок может начинаться синхронно с созданием основного программы.
Подобный подход, знакомый как "сдвиг влево" в проверке, значительно сокращает цену коррекции багов, поскольку их выявление и исправление на начальных фазах предполагает меньших расходов времени и средств. Кроме того, начальное включение специалистов в ход помогает формированию совместного осознания проекта у всей команды создания вавада казино.
Какие типы проверок задействуют: вручную и программно
Человеческое испытание является незаменимым средством для контроля клиентского опыта, экспериментального проверки и тестирования сложных бизнес-сценариев. Эксперты реализуют задачу итоговых клиентов, контактируя с системой через визуальный взаимодействие и анализируя комфорт применения, понятность функционирования и согласованность предположениям.
Поисковое тестирование обеспечивает обнаружить внезапные дефекты и сложности, которые не были заложены в формальных проверках. Опытные специалисты задействуют свое осознание предметной области и техническую интуицию для поиска вероятных слабых мест в приложении.
Автоматизированное проверка продуктивно для тестирования повторяющихся вариантов, повторного тестирования и проверки больших массивов информации. Механизированные проверки могут выполняться непрерывно, не предполагают участия человека и предоставляют стабильные результаты тестирования.
Модульное тестирование контролирует индивидуальные компоненты системы vavada в обособленности от прочей системы. Кодеры формируют тесты для своего скрипта, которые активируются при каждом изменении и помогают быстро обнаруживать неполадки на стадии изолированных возможностей или классов.
Объединительное тестирование сосредотачивается на тестировании связи между разными элементами и компонентами программы. Оно помогает найти неполадки в взаимодействиях, передаче данных между частями и общей построении продукта.
Каким образом находят баги на отличающихся стадиях создания
На фазе составления планов и проектирования неточности находятся через анализ технических спецификаций, исследование конструкционных вариантов и имитацию клиентских случаев. Эксперты различных профилей исследуют материалы, находят потенциальные неполадки и предлагают оптимизации до инициирования активной программирования.
Во момент разработки программы кодеры применяют фиксированный исследование скрипта, который программно контролирует программу вавада казино на совместимость стандартам написания, потенциальные проблемы безопасности и стандартные дефекты кодирования. Нынешние объединенные окружения создания содержат инструменты, которые отмечают неполадки непосредственно в ходе написания программы.
Код-ревью представляет собой процесс взаимной анализа скрипта программистами. Сотрудники исследуют написанный скрипт с точки зрения логики работы, согласованности нормам группы, возможных проблем производительности и перспектив для улучшения. Этот ход не только способствует выявить ошибки, но и способствует распространению опытом в команде.
Подвижное проверка проводится на действующей приложении и охватывает разнообразные виды рабочего и дополнительного испытания. Тестировщики стартуют программу с разными входными данными, тестируют работу в крайних обстоятельствах и анализируют выводы выполнения.
Почему важно проверять секьюрность и оборону информации
Безопасность технических продуктов vavada является жизненно необходимым фактором качества в эпоху цифровизации и увеличивающихся киберугроз. Взломы защиты могут привести не только к денежным ущербу, но и к критическому урону престижу фирмы, утрате уверенности заказчиков и правовым последствиям.
Тестирование секьюрности содержит проверку подтверждения и доступа клиентов, обороны от главных видов нападений, таких как внедрения запросов, XSS и фальсификация межсайтовых запросов. Специалисты по безопасности исследуют архитектуру программы с точки зрения вероятных рисков и проверяют эффективность установленных оборонительных способов.
Оборона индивидуальных данных предполагает повышенного сосредоточенности в связи с повышением строгости юридических требований в направлении конфиденциальности. Системы обязаны корректно обрабатывать, хранить и передавать чувствительную сведения, гарантировать способность ликвидации данных по запросу пользователей и соблюдать основы минимизации получения материалов.
Кодировочная оборона материалов вавада тестируется на предмет задействования новейших алгоритмов защиты, корректной реализации протоколов безопасности и корректного регулирования ключами. Уязвимости в защите могут превратить всю структуру защиты бесполезной.
Как тестируют быстроту, нагрузку и устойчивость
Производительность софта проверяется через комплекс нагрузочных испытаний, которые имитируют различные варианты эксплуатации программы в реальных обстоятельствах. Загрузочное тестирование определяет, как приложение функционирует при ожидаемом числе пользователей и операций.
Предельное проверка способствует найти момент сбоя системы, поэтапно увеличивая загрузку до предельных параметров. Это позволяет осознать лимиты возможностей программы и проверить, насколько корректно она ухудшается при чрезмерной нагрузке.
Тестирование надежности охватывает долгосрочные тестирование работы программы вавада казино под постоянной напряжением для нахождения утечек ресурсов, планомерного уменьшения производительности и других проблем, которые демонстрируются только при долговременной деятельности.
Наблюдение производительности во время тестирования содержит наблюдение использования процессора, оперативной памяти, хранилища и коммуникационных возможностей. Эти метрики содействуют выявить ограничения в архитектуре и оптимизировать быстродействие приложения.
Что выполняют, если ошибка найдена перед релизом
Обнаружение ошибки перед выпуском разработки запускает процедуру оценки критичности сложности и выработки выбора о последующих мерах. Серьезные баги, которые могут вызвать к утрате материалов, нарушению секьюрности или абсолютной неисправности системы, нуждаются немедленного исправления.
Процедура контроля багами охватывает подробное документирование выявленной сложности с обозначением действий для повторения, окружения, в котором выражается дефект, и ожидаемого функционирования приложения. Отдел создания анализирует ошибку, выявляет источник и составляет планы коррекцию.
Сортировка исправлений строится на влиянии бага на клиентов вавада, периодичности ее демонстрации и сложности ликвидации. Определенные незначительные сложности могут быть отложены до следующего запуска, если их исправление требует значительных модификаций в программе.
После исправления дефекта осуществляется подтверждающее испытание, которое подтверждает, что проблема исправлена, а также возвратное испытание для контроля того, что коррекция не вызвало к возникновению новых багов в других компонентах системы.




